Адрес канала:
Категории:
Технологии
Язык: Русский
Количество подписчиков:
6.15K
Описание канала:
SQL Pro - всё об SQL
Реклама: @anothertechrock
Контент канала:
1. Разбор вопросов с собеседований
2. Трюки SQL
3. Видео
4. Тесты
5. Задачи на логику
6. Юмор
Рейтинги и Отзывы
Оценить канал sqlprofi и оставить отзыв — могут только зарегестрированные пользователи. Все отзывы проходят модерацию.
5 звезд
1
4 звезд
0
3 звезд
1
2 звезд
1
1 звезд
0
Последние сообщения 2
2022-08-19 09:00:12
859 voters2.7K views06:00
2022-08-17 18:00:13
Трюк дня.
Возвратить 0 для функции SUM
если не найдено ни одного значения в MySQL. Решение
SELECT COALESCE(SUM(column_1),0)
FROM table
WHERE column_2 = ‘Test‘;
#tips
2.5K views15:00
2022-08-17 09:00:11
Трюк дня.
Возвратить 0 для функции SUM
если не найдено ни одного значения в MySQL Перепишите запрос так, чтобы он возвратил 0, если для функции SUM не найдено ни одного значения, кроме NULLs.
И возвратил сумму, если значения найдены.
SELECT SUM (column_1)
FROM table
WHERE column_2 = ‘Test‘;
Решение будет вечером.
#tips
2.5K views06:00
2022-08-15 09:00:10
2.8K views06:00
2022-08-13 18:00:09
Ответ на #вопрос30
UPDATE tbl
SET nmbr =
CASE WHEN nmbr = 0
THEN nmbr + 2
ELSE nmbr + 3
END;
#вопросы #собеседование
2.8K views15:00
2022-08-13 09:00:09
#вопрос30
В таблице tbl в поле nmbr содержатся записи со следующими значениями:
1, 0, 0, 1, 1, 1, 1, 0, 0.
Напишите запрос, который добавит 2, если значение nmbr = 0 и добавит 3, если значение nmbr = 1.
#вопросы #собеседование
2.9K views06:00
2022-08-11 09:00:13
796 voters3.4K views06:00
2022-08-09 18:00:10
Трюк дня.
Изменить тип поля с CHARACTER на NUMERIC в PostgreSQL. Решение
ALTER TABLE customers
ALTER COLUMN age
TYPE NUMERIC (10,0)
USING age::NUMERIC;
ИЛИ
ALTER TABLE customers
ALTER COLUMN age
TYPE NUMERIC (10,0)
USING CAST(age AS NUMERIC);
#tips
3.1K views15:00
2022-08-09 09:00:15
Трюк дня.
Изменить тип поля с CHARACTER на NUMERIC в PostgreSQL В PostgreSQL таблице customers колонка age имеет тип CHARACTER(20).
Напишите запрос, который приведёт данную колонку к типу NUMERIC (10,0).
Решение будет вечером.
#tips
3.2K views06:00
2022-08-05 18:00:12
Ответ на #вопрос29
• DDL
(Data Definition Language, язык описания данных
) — позволяет выполнять различные операции с базой данных, такие как CREATE (создание), ALTER (изменение) и DROP (удаление объектов).
• DML (Data Manipulation Language, язык управления данными) — позволяет получать доступ к данным и манипулировать ими, например, вставлять, обновлять, удалять и извлекать данные из базы данных.
• DCL (Data Control Language, язык контролирования данных) — позволяет контролировать доступ к базе данных. Пример — GRANT (предоставить права), REVOKE (отозвать права).
#вопросы #собеседование
3.9K views15:00